About This Book

Have you ever felt scared but wished you weren’t? Lenny and Lucy believe nothing and no one can scare them—until they each discover a secret fear. What happens when best friends face their fears together?

Quick Assessment

This picture book for early readers explores the theme of childhood fears through the story of two best friends who learn to share and overcome their anxieties. Suitable for ages 5-8, it offers a gentle and reassuring message about friendship and courage. The story uses relatable fears like scary movies and spiders to help children understand that fears are normal and can be faced with support.
